ABSTRACT

Objective@#To investigate the pathogenic characteristics of viral encephalitis in children living in Hebei province.@*Methods@#We randomly collected cerebrospinal fluid specimens from a total of 399 children diagnosed with viral encephalitis in Hebei Children′s Hospital from May to December 2017. Real-time fluorescence quantitative PCR and Sanger sequencing were used to detect viral nucleic acids in cerebrospinal fluid by an automatic laboratory station. Statistical analysis was performed on the experimental data using SPSS 21.0 software and the clinical data were analyzed. Comparison of infection rates of EV encephalitis in different months, using line × column chi-square test. The MRI and EEG positive rates of different viral encephalitis and viral encephalitis patients not infected with the virus were analyzed by Fisher′s exact probability test. The positive rate of infection with different viruses and non-virus agents was analyzed by Fisher′s exact probability test.@*Results@#The result showed that 80 of 399 samples were positive, and the positive rate was 20.05%. It included 22 cases of enterovirus, 4 cases of influenza A virus, 3 cases of mumps virus, 2 cases of herpes simplex virus type 1, 1 case of herpes simplex virus type 2, 4 cases of EB virus, 7 cases of cytomegalovirus, 7 cases of herpes zoster virus, 8 cases of adenovirus, 14 cases of human herpesvirus type 6. Eight cases had combined viral infection. Eight cases had concurrent infections: 3 cases had enterovirus and herpesvirus type 6 concurrent infection, 1 case had enterovirus and Japanese encephalitis virus concurrent infection and 1 case had herpes simplex virus type 2 and adenovirus, 1 case had influenza A virus herpesvirus type 6, 1 case had mumps virus and herpesvirus type 6, 1 case had mumps virus and herpesvirus type 6, 1 case had herpes simplex virus type 1 and herpes zoster virus concurrent infections. Children with EV viral encephalitis in Hebei Province were highly prevalent in May and June (P=0.016). HHV6 virus encephalitis was more susceptible to infection than non-HHV6 virus (P=0.016); The rate of MRI positive findings in patients with different viral encephalitis was not statistically significant (P>0.05). The result of EEG of different viral encephalitis were P>0.05, which was not statistically significant.@*Conclusions@#EV was the most common pathogen of children with viral encephalitis in Hebei province. Encephalitis caused by influenza A virus cannot be ignored in clinical practice.
